Our vision

In 2120, the Mississippi Delta won't look much different from the one you see today. But one takes a closer look, suddenly small but important changes appear evident; fields have become more harmonious with the landscape, and intertwine with solar farms and extensive water features; although the floodplain is not as large as it once was, the river now has more wiggle space to do what it must. The cities have become much greener, less hot during summer, and homes are safe and well lit even during the most intense hurricanes. Looking out at sea, one will see the marshes expanding again, and between the leaves of the mangroves spot wind turbines were oil rigs once crowded the horizon.

Our inventory & analysis

We,ve taken into consideration the environmental, geological and socio-economic context of the area to help identify the core problem to be excessive river velocity caused by levee confinement and increased precipitation. To address this problem we believe the restoration of the floodplain should be prioritized, progressing side to side with Coastal protection, Agricultural adaptation and Energy transition as a way to shift major production activities from being part of the problem to part of the solution.
